Vanillaware is very much tied to Atlus. I'm surprised at the lack of requests for Dragon's Crown.

Making games even on mobile is an expensive business especially when you have many mouths to feed.
Years ago, the average mobile game budget in Japan was $6 million USD. It's only gone up.
